The problem with on/off circulators:
Whats’ wrong with what we have been doing for years? We have all sized circulators for largest heating load in the next 50 years for every job at every zone. We are required to size for the worse case. What is the cost? We use a lot of energy over pumping our jobs when there is no need and often end up creating velocity sound problems. Most heating systems spend most of their operating hours at 1/2 the rated heat requirement, or less, but the circulator is working at full speed using full speed energy whenever called upon. Matching the flow of a circulator to the actual heating load makes a lot of sense. Now we can get smaaaarter the easy way.
So How Do you Size a regular circulator now?
If you are like most hydronic contractors and distributors, you select a circulator that seems somewhere close to the correct size based on a guess at pressure drop and flow requirements. In fact, even the most careful circulator sizing is based on calculated estimates that usually are not close to the actual pressure drop in an installed system. Estimates with correction factors are the norm. This is why most circulators are over sized for the application. Many practical contractors will buy a 3 speed circulator and switch speeds until velocity noise goes away. This approach makes sense to manage sound but it does nothing for efficiency or comfort. Delta T vs Delta P:
Variable speed Delta T beats out Euro Delta P technology:
A Taco VDT Delta T circulator measures the temperature difference between supply and return pipes and varies flow according to the heat required, just like a modulating boiler. You simply set the differential required for the job on a dial (usually 10 -20 delta T) and the circulator does all the thinking required to get it right every time, adjusting speed as the load and number of zone vary.
A Delta P circulator requires a complicated setup based upon estimated pressure drop calculation, which not what is actually happening in the system or you must perform a complicated commercial pressure balancing set up. These circulators were designed by European engineers for the European market that involves extensive training. Taco Delta T circulators responds to the actual, real time load rather than calculated estimates of pressure drop, which may or may not actually reflect the system requirements. While some Delta P circulators can deliver superior rated efficiencies, the actual field performance of a Delta P circulator will often fall far short of the calculated estimates. Common Uses:


Use a VDT circulator when utilizing multiple zone valves or radiant actuator to automatically ajust flow to changing loads. Use a VDT circulator to circulate directly from a high mass boiler or water heater. A VDT circulator is an ideal choice when changing the circulator of an existing cast iron boiler installation with unknown flow and head losses.
Proper VDT Applications:
Taco VDT circulators are ideal for any variable load zoning conditions. They are also compatible with primary pumping to high mass on/off boilers and water heaters.
Variable speed circulators are not compatible with primary pumping to low mass modulating boilers, which have their own modulating logic. |
